    Research progress on effects of weightlessness on vascular ndothelial cell and its mechanism

    • Weightlessness can lead to change the structure and function of endothelial cells, autophagy and endoplasmic reticulum stress are cells in order to maintain its steady state and response to environmental changes and the stress response, study shows that the simulated weightlessness can improve the standards of vascular endothelial cell proliferation, apoptosis is restrained, cell migration, These physiological changes were accompanied by enhanced autophagy activity of vascular endothelial cells, and increased apoptosis in er stress induced by weightlessness, suggesting that autophagy and ER stress may play a regulatory role in the functional changes of vascular endothelial cells induced by weightlessness. This paper reviews the role of autophagy and endoplasmic reticulum stress in the functional changes of vascular endothelial cells induced by weightlessness.
